WILLIAMSBURG, Va. – Junior
Kenna Zier and freshman
Ivey Crain recorded a goal and an assist as William & Mary drew Monmouth, 2-2, on Sunday afternoon at Martin Family Stadium at Albert-Daly Field.
The Tribe (6-5-4, 2-1-3 CAA) opened the scoring in the fourth minute as Zier found the back of the net in her third-straight game. Graduate student
Cricket Basa sent cross in from along the right endline that Crain tried to volley. Monmouth defender Gabby Allen was able to block the Tribe rookie's shot, but it fell to Zier who finished from six yards out over the top of Monmouth goalkeeper Cassandra Coster.
W&M doubled its lead less than three minutes into the second half. Zier sent in a cross from the left wing. It ended up on the foot of Crain whose low-lining shot found the left side of the net for her team-leading eighth goal of the season. Crain increased her CAA-leading goal (5) and point (13) totals in league games. She has also registered at last a point in all six conference matches this season.
The Tribe joined top-10 Penn State as the only teams to score multiple goals against one of the nation's top defenses. Monmouth (10-2-2, 3-1-2 CAA) started the week ranked No. 19 nationally in GAA (0.54) and 19th in shutout % (61.5).
The Hawks, which had allowed just six goals on the year entering Sunday, pulled one back in the 58th minute. Following a corner kick, A'Liah Moore headed home a Lauren Karabin cross from eight yards out to close the gap to 2-1.
The visitor found the equalizer with less than five minutes remaining on a scrum in front of the Tribe net. Senior goalkeeper
Zoe Doughty saved an initial shot from Monmouth's Julia Evernham just outside the six. The rebound spilled over and was eventually collected and finished by Ava Allen from the top of the six.
Each team finished with nine shots on the afternoon. The Tribe put seven of the chances on from frame compared to just four for Monmouth. The Hawks tallied four corner kicks, while W&M had two.
